Bob Smith
New York, New York, United States
*50 free lookup(s) per month.
No credit card required.
Bob Smith’s Email al1222@excite.com
Social Media
Bob Smith’s Location New York, New York, United States
Bob Smith’s Current Industry
Bob Smith’s Prior Industry
Not the Bob Smith you were looking for?
Find accurate emails & phone numbers for over 700M professionals.